Uffington Drive has fantastic transport links being a short walk to Martins Heron Station and also less than a ten minute drive to Bracknell Station/ Town Centre. Bracknell has undergone some significant investment over the past few years and now boasts an excellent shopping centre in The Lexicon which has a whole array of high street and independent retailers, cafes, restaurants, and bars. The town sits ideally between the M4 and M3 motorways and the train station offers direct links to Reading and London Waterloo.
